For your dad who enjoys martial arts, there are several thoughtful and meaningful gift ideas that can enhance his passion for practicing and learning different forms of martial arts. Here are a few suggestions that might inspire you:
1. Martial Arts Training Gear: Consider purchasing high-quality training gear that aligns with your dad's preferred martial arts style. This could include a new judo gi (uniform), a pair of taekwondo sparring gloves and shin guards, or a traditional kung fu uniform. Good quality gear can greatly enhance his comfort and performance during training sessions.
2. Martial Arts Books: Help your dad expand his knowledge and techniques by gifting him a few books on martial arts. Look for titles that cover various concepts, history, or provide detailed instructions on specific techniques. Some popular choices include "Judo: history, theory, practice" by Robert Van de Walle, "Tae Kwon Do: The Ultimate Reference Guide to the World's Most Popular Martial Art" by Yeon Hwan Park, and "The Shaolin Monastery: History, Religion, and the Chinese Martial Arts" by Meir Shahar.
